On Friday, July 23, 2021, Joseph John Mlynarski Sr. loving husband, father, and grandfather passed away in his home surrounded by his family at age 76. Joseph was born on August 15, 1944 in Niles, Ohio to Alexander and Helen Turowski Mlynarski. He graduated from Ursuline High School and attended Youngstown State University. At age 23 he was drafted into the Army where he served as a combat medic in the Vietnam War. During his service he was awarded the Bronze Star, the Silver Star, and the Purple Heart. Joseph was a member of the Knights of Columbus 3rd and 4th degree of Girard counsel and also the First Catholic Slovak Ladies Association. He was a postal carrier for 30 years.
He is survived by his loving wife of more than 50 years, Rosemary; son, Joe (Michele); and daughter, Michele. Joseph was a proud grandfather to four grandkids, Haley, Katie, Ryan, and Jimmy. He is also survived by his sister, MaryAnn Mlynarski. Joseph was preceded in death by his parents Alexander and Helen Mlynarski.
